There are virtually 30,000 helped living homes in the United States.


The majority of these residents are mobile people over the age of 65. Those that need a mobility device to relocate around or deal with behavior or cognitive disabilities are usually dissuaded from transferring to an assisted living center because they require even more specific treatment - Charlotte Assisted Living. Although a lot of helped living residents ultimately move on to taking care of homes, some locals leave assisted living homes to return home or transfer to another aided living facility.


Pet dogs are likewise permitted in numerous assisted living homes. Individuals living in an assisted living home commonly reside in their very own private or semi-private apartment or condos. These residences normally consist of a bed room, washroom and kitchen area, however this can vary from one facility to one more. Homeowners get everyday aid with normal jobs such as consuming, dressing and bathing.


Various other assisted living services may consist of housekeeping, wellness solutions, recreational activities, laundry solutions, social and spiritual tasks, transportation services, third-party nursing care with a home wellness firm, 24-hour security and health care.
